What to do post-septoplasty and antrostomy surgery?

This Premium Q&A, reviewed and published, features a real conversation between an iCliniq user and a physician.

Patient's Query

Hi doctor,

I had septoplasty and maxillary antrostomy four weeks back, but I still have swelling in the nose. My Rhinocort nose spray does not stay in my nose when I spray it. I rinse my nose with saline four times a day, and still, my nose is dry. I am going to get a doctor's appointment after eight weeks, is it too late? Is it normal that nose spray will not stay in the nose?

After the surgery, it is advised you schedule an appointment with the ENT surgeon in about a week. This visit enables the surgeon to assess the healing, any crusting, infection, etc. Eight weeks may be too late. The nasal spray forms a mist inside the nose when you spray, which is sufficient. Make sure you direct the Rhinocort (Budesonide) spray laterally and not towards the septum (the midline) so that it acts on the maxillary antrostomy area (lateral wall of the nose). Ideally, do the saline washes thoroughly, follow it up with the Rhinocort spray and not vice versa. It is normal if after the spray some amount of it spills down from the nose or goes into the throat. Your nose should not be dry. I would suggest you use 0.5 % Menthol paraffin nasal drops for lubrication, after consulting your doctor. These drops are excellent and do not cause any irritation. Dryness should be prevented by all means because it hampers with mucociliary clearance, causing stasis and predispose to infection. Hope you feel better soon. Do revert if you need any more help.
